Hit-And-Run Driver At Large In Pacific Beach
SAN DIEGO — A hit-and-run driver was still at large Saturday after injuring a bicycle rider in Pacific Beach, police said. The accident near Garnet Avenue and Noyes Street was reported at 12:04 a.m., said San Diego police Sgt. Rich Nemetz.
A blue pickup truck was headed south on Morrell Street to westbound Garnet Avenue, and a 26-year-old man on a bike who was riding east along Garnet, Nemetz said. Nemetz said the truck circled the block, then left.
The injured man was taken to a hospital with a compound fracture to his left leg, Nemetz said. The truck was described as a medium size, regular cab with tinted windows.
